Key Terms
Term Definitions Content Valuation The process of making value judgments on content (e.g., comments, articles, photos), usually done by a system or human evaluator. Rewards An incentive mechanism given to content contributors based on the results of content value assessment, usually in the form of digital currency or points. Content Contributors Users who create, upload, or share content, such as writing comments, publishing articles, uploading photos, etc. Evaluators Individuals or systems that evaluate the value of content. Blockchain A decentralized, distributed database used to record transaction data, with the characteristics of security and transparency. Smart contracts Self-executing contracts stored on the blockchain that are used to regulate and enforce predefined rules. On-chain transactions Records of transactions conducted on the blockchain network. DApp (decentralized application) Applications developed on the blockchain platform, with the characteristics of decentralization, security and transparency. Merchants Merchants who accept reward points or digital currency as a payment method. Platforms that provide content value assessment and reward system services, such as social media platforms, e-commerce platforms, etc. Short Answer Questions
What is the main purpose of the content value assessment and reward system?
The content value assessment and reward system aims to motivate users to create high-quality content and quantitatively evaluate the value of the content, thereby promoting the production and dissemination of high-quality content.
What role does blockchain technology play in the content value assessment and reward system?
Blockchain technology can be used to record information such as content contribution, evaluation results and reward issuance to ensure that the data is transparent, secure and tamper-proof.
What are the application scenarios of smart contracts in the content value assessment and reward system?
Smart contracts can be used to automatically execute reward issuance rules, such as automatically issuing rewards to content contributors and evaluators based on evaluation results.
Compared with traditional content platforms, what are the advantages of blockchain-based content value assessment and reward systems?
Blockchain-based systems are more transparent and fair, and can effectively avoid the manipulation of content value assessment and reward issuance by centralized platforms.
What are the ways to assess content value?
Content value assessment can be done by manual evaluation, algorithm evaluation, or a combination of the two, depending on the content type and platform rules.
How can the reward issuance mechanism be designed to better motivate user participation?
A differentiated reward mechanism can be adopted to issue different levels of rewards based on factors such as content quality and influence to encourage users to create better content.
How do merchants participate in the content value assessment and reward system?
Merchants can accept reward points or digital currency as payment methods, or participate by sponsoring content creation or providing other forms of cooperation.
What challenges does the content value assessment and reward system face?
Challenges include how to ensure the fairness of the assessment, how to prevent cheating, how to handle the storage and calculation of massive data, etc.
What is the development trend of the content value assessment and reward system in the future?
In the future, there may be more intelligent and personalized content value assessment and reward systems, as well as more diverse application scenarios.
Please give examples of the application of content value assessment and reward systems in real life.
For example, e-commerce platforms can issue reward points based on the quality and helpfulness of user comments, and users can use the points to redeem goods or enjoy other discounts.
